WebAug 17, 2024 · HashTable和HashMap在代码实现上,基本上是一样的,和Vector与Arraylist的区别大体上差不多,一个是线程安全的,一个非线程安全,忘记了的朋友可以去看这篇文章,传送门: Arraylist与Vector的区别 。. ConcurrentHashMap也是线程安全的,但性能比HashTable好很多,HashTable是锁 ... WebJun 11, 2015 · 与Dictionary相比,List可以看成下标到值的映射,HashSet可以看成值自己到自己的映射。. 判断一个值是否存在,前者相当于是用值去找下标,要遍历一遍容器;后者相当于用映射前的值去找映射后的值,只需要计算出来值的hash,然后直接访问就好了。. 赞同 ...
Working With HashSet In C# - c-sharpcorner.com
WebNov 16, 2024 · SortedSet: a sorted collection without duplicates. To sort those items, we have two approaches. You can simply sort the collection once you’ve finished adding items: Or, even better, use the right data structure: a SortedSet. Both results print Bari,Naples,Rome,Turin. Webnew HashSet(x.id).SetEquals(new HashSet(y.id)) myObjects.Select(x=>new{myObject=x,hashSet=newhashset(x.id)}) .GroupBy(x=>x.hashSet,hashSet.CreateSetComparer()) .SelectMany(x=>x.GroupBy(y=>y.myObject.dept)) 如果只想执行一个 GroupBy , … injury lawyer mclean
HashSet Class (System.Collections.Generic)
WebDec 21, 2024 · 从HashSet 中删除某一个元素可以调用 Remove 方法,它的语法结构如下:. public bool Remove (T item); 如果在集合中找到了这个元素,Remove方法将会删除这个元素并且返回true,否则返回 false。. 下面的代码片段展示了如何使用 Remove 方法删除 HashSet 中的元素. string item = "D ... WebRemarks. If Count already equals the capacity of the HashSet object, the capacity is automatically adjusted to accommodate the new item. If Count is less than the capacity of the internal array, this method is an O (1) operation. If the HashSet object must be resized, this method becomes an O ( n) operation, where n is Count. () to provide identity of instances in the set collection by Key property value. to make this collection work as fast as possible for Contain ... injury lawyer marysville wa